I applied online. I interviewed at XYZ (New Delhi) in May 2025
Interview
The interview process typically starts with application screening, where your resume is reviewed. Next is a recruiter call to assess basic fit and expectations. Then comes a technical assessment (coding/test). Successful candidates attend technical interviews to evaluate skills in depth. A managerial round checks problem-solving, teamwork, and role fit. After that, an HR discussion covers salary, policies, and culture. Finally, background verification is done before the offer is released.
I applied through a recruiter. I interviewed at XYZ (Chennai)
Interview
JavaScript / TypeScript basics
Angular concepts (components, services, routing)
Node.js basics
Some simple coding questions Deep questions:
How APIs work
Microservices (you asked earlier)
Database (MongoDB queries)
Real-time scenarios
👉 Example:
How frontend talks to backend?
How to design API?
How to handle errors?
The interview experience was insightful and engaging. Questions focused on machine learning concepts, project explanations, and problem-solving skills. The interviewer was supportive, and the process helped improve confidence and technical understanding.
Interview questions [1]
Question 1
They asked me to explain one of my machine learning projects, including the problem statement, approach, algorithms used, and how I handled challenges during implementation.
Wonderful experience , good to see the team in action and happy to be part of it as well as the team in the future as well as to the team in general and the team
Top companies for "Compensation and Benefits" near you